Transaction dcc4deb074a028aea9437a26fab60cb42caa39ecd4568e605bfbb3baed590f84
1 Input
1 Output
-
dcc4deb074a028aea9437a26fab60cb42caa39ecd4568e605bfbb3baed590f84:0
- value
- 1042364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b357fdf299dd4cdf3ab05854860642f18fae00b OP_EQUAL
- address
- 3QbHcuMmfJLp1tWvboWZEcXNpUNVzNReib